QUESTION NO: 2
The effect of a change in accounting principle that is inseparable from the effect of a change in accounting estimate should be reported:
A. By restating the financial statements of all prior periods presented.
B. As a component of income from continuing operations, in the period of change and future periods if the change affects both.
C. As a separate disclosure after income from continuing operations, in the period of change and future periods if the change affects both.
D. As a correction of an error.
Answer: B

QUESTION NO: 3
Arpco, Inc., a for-profit provider of healthcare services, recently purchased two smaller companies and is researching accounting issues arising from the two business combinations. Which of the following accounting pronouncements are the most authoritative?
A. AICPA Industry and Audit Guides.
B. AICA Statements of Position.
C. FASB Statements of Financial Accounting Concepts.
D. FASB Statements of Financial Accounting Standards.
Answer: D
